搜书网 本次搜索耗时 0.096 秒,为您找到 292 个相关结果.
  • 13. 服务器与部署

    服务器与部署 平台即服务 (PaaS) 虚拟或专用服务器 nginx 和 PHP-FPM Apache 和 PHP 共享主机 构建和部署您的应用程序 部署工具 扩展阅读: 服务器布置 延伸阅读: 持续集成 延伸阅读: 服务器与部署 部署 PHP 应用程序到生产环境中有多种方式。 平台即服务 (PaaS) PaaS 提供了...
  • 14.7 文件锁

    14.7 文件锁 14.7 文件锁 Linux内核提供了基于文件的互斥锁,而Nginx框架封装了3个方法,提供给Nginx模块使用文件互斥锁来保护共享数据。下面首先介绍一下这种基于文件的互斥锁是如何使用的,其实很简单,通过fcntl方法就可以实现。 int fcntl(int fd,int cmd,struct flock*lock); 这个...
  • 2.2.5 在配置中使用变量

    2.2.5 在配置中使用变量 2.2.5 在配置中使用变量 有些模块允许在配置项中使用变量,如在日志记录部分,具体示例如下。 log_format main'$remote_addr-$remote_user[$time_local]"$request"' '$status$bytes_sent"$http_referer"' '"$http...
  • pmap

    pmap 补充说明 语法 选项 参数 实例 pmap 报告进程的内存映射关系 补充说明 pmap命令 用于报告进程的内存映射关系,是Linux调试及运维一个很好的工具。 语法 pmap (选项)(参数) 选项 - x :显示扩展格式; - d :显示设备格式; - q :不显示头尾行; - V :显示指...
  • 200天的Showcase

    200天的Showcase 一些项目简述 技术栈 google map solr polygon 搜索 技能树 重构Skill Tree 技能树Sherlock Django Ionic ElasticSearch 地图搜索 简历生成器 Nginx 大数据学习 其他 200天的Showcase 今天是我连续泡在GitHub上的第2...
  • 03

    7.8.2 用于新建清单的URL和视图 7.8.3 删除当前多余的代码和测试 7.8.4 出现回归!让表单指向刚添加的新URL 7.9 下定决心,调整模型 7.9.1 外键关系 7.9.2 根据新模型定义调整其他代码 7.10 每个列表都应该有自己的URL 7.10.1 捕获URL中的参数 7.10.2 按照新设计调整new_list 视图 ...
  • 4.4 error日志的用法

    4.4 error日志的用法 define ngx_log_error(level,log,args……) define ngx_log_debug(level,log,args……) 4.4 error日志的用法 Nginx的日志模块(这里所说的日志模块是ngx_errlog_module模块,而ngx_http_log_module模块是用于...
  • 9.6 epoll事件驱动模块

    9.6 epoll事件驱动模块 9.6.1 epoll的原理和用法 9.6 epoll事件驱动模块 本章9.1节~9.5节都在探讨Nginx是如何设计事件驱动框架、如何管理不同的事件驱动模块的,但本节中将以epoll为例,讨论Linux操作系统内核是如何实现epoll事件驱动机制的,在简单了解它的用法后,会进一步说明ngx_epoll_module...
  • 12.7.2 转发响应的包体

    12.7.2 转发响应的包体 12.7.2 转发响应的包体 当接收到上游服务器的响应时,将会由ngx_http_upstream_process_non_buffered_upstream方法处理连接上的这个读事件,该方法比较简单,下面直接列举源代码说明其流程。 static void ngx_http_upstream_process_non_...
  • 3.2.2 ngx_str_t数据结构

    3.2.2 ngx_str_t数据结构 define ngx_strncmp(s1,s2,n)strncmp((const char)s1,(const char)s2,n) 3.2.2 ngx_str_t数据结构 在Nginx的领域中,ngx_str_t结构就是字符串。ngx_str_t的定义如下: typedef struct{ size...